Elimination of Systematic Error in the Measurement of Group Delay of Frequency Convertor

  The influence of spectral leakage is analyzed theoretically when the two-tone method and the all-phase discrete Fourier transformation (apDFT) are utilized to measure the group delay of a frequency convertor. Owing to the spectral leakage, the spectral lines of the two tones interact, and the interaction arouses errors in the measurement of group delay. Then, an I/Q method is put forward to eliminate the interaction. Simulations with a frequency convertor demonstrate the feasibility of the I/Q method in eliminating the interaction.
